  • How does AST works?

    AST (aspartate aminotransferase) is an enzyme that is found mostly in the liver, but it's also in muscles and other organs in your body.
    When cells that contain AST are damaged, they release the AST into your blood.
    An AST blood test measures the amount of AST in your blood.Apr 8, 2022.

  • How is ALT and AST produced?

    Alanine aminotranferease (ALT) and aspartate aminotransferase (AST) are enzymes located in liver cells that leak out into the general circulation when liver cells are injured.
    These two enzymes were previously known as the SGPT (serum glutamic-pyruvic transaminase) and the SGOT (serum glutaic-oxaloacetic transaminase)..

  • What is ALT and AST in biochemistry?

    Aspartate aminotransferase (AST), formerly termed glutamate oxaloacetate transaminase (GOT), and alanine aminotransferase (ALT), formerly termed glutamate pyruvate transaminase (GPT), are the two aminotransferases of greatest clinical significance..

  • What is the function of AST in biochemistry?

    Aspartate Aminotransferase (AST)
    AST catalyzes a reaction between the amino acids aspartate and glutamate and is an important enzyme in amino acid metabolism.
    AST is found in the liver, heart, skeletal muscle, kidneys, brain, and red blood cells..

  • Why do we do AST and ALT?

    The primary clinical application of serum AST and ALT measurement is the detection and differential etiologic diagnosis of hepatic disease.
    Hepatic cell injury is manifested by elevated serum transaminase activity prior to the appearance of clinical symptoms and signs (such as jaundice)..

  • SUMMARY OF TEST PRINCIPLE AND CLINICAL RELEVANCE
    The DxC uses an enzymatic rate method to measure the AST activity in serum or plasma.
    In the reaction, the AST catalyzes the reversible transamination of L-aspartate and α-ketoglutarate to oxaloacetate and L-glutamate.
  • Typically the range for normal AST is reported between 10 to 40 units per liter and ALT between 7 to 56 units per liter.
    Mild elevations are generally considered to be 2-3 times higher than the normal range.
    In some conditions, these enzymes can be severely elevated, in the 1000s range.

What is AST enzyme?

AST catalyzes the reversible transfer of an α-amino group between aspartate and glutamate and, as such, is an important enzyme in amino acid metabolism.
AST is found in the liver, heart, skeletal muscle, kidneys, brain, red blood cells and gall bladder.

Where does AST protein come from?

The AST protein mainly occurs in the liver and heart.
With liver damage, AST can leak from the liver into the bloodstream.
When this happens, AST levels in the blood will be higher than normal.
AST also occurs in the brain, heart, kidneys, and muscles.
If there is damage in any of these areas, AST levels may also increase.
